SpletHeat shrink substrates are comprised of a number of polymers. The most common include OPS (Oriented Polystyrene), P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ride), PETg (Polyester) and Polyolefins. Additionally, combination films, Hybrid or Multilayer films, and speciality films like White Opaque (Figure 2.1) also round out the substrate offerings. The distribution database is just a regular system database, so yes, you can shrink it the same way as you do with all the other databases (It is located under the … sc frankfurt 80 hockeySplet06. jun. 2024 · Inventory shrinkage is a hit to warehouse margins and annual revenue caused by loss of goods between time of manufacture and point of sale. The primary sources of inventory shrinkage are damage, spoilage, misplacement, and employee theft. Human error in the inventory tracking and management process can also be a root cause. rusch asherman chest seal
